The Bible teaches that God is one in essence yet exists eternally in three distinct persons: the Father, the Son, and the Holy Spirit. These three are co-equal, co-eternal, and fully God, sharing the same divine nature while performing distinct roles in the work of creation, redemption, and sanctification.
(Mathew 28:19) (Colossians 2:9)
(2 Corinthians 1:21-22)
